Hillary and Ohio ...

Looks like Hillary Clinton has a pretty big lead in Ohio.  ... She's also up in Pennsylvania.  I'm sure she wishes the elections were today -- not on March 4 ... 
Advertisement


I can't help but feel the "rust-belt" vote leans toward Hillary. 

Aside from the support she has from the Ohio's governor, it just feels like Ohio is the kind of state she would do well in. 

Update:  MSNBC is now reporting that the first Super Delegate to switch sides has just switched her vote from HIllary to Obama.  Might this be a harbinger of things to come???
